According to islam for marriage the condition is

  1. no dowry is allowed

  2. bride's parent should give the dowry demanded by bridegroom's parent

  3. bridegroom should give dowry to bride's parents

  4. bridegroom should give the dowry to bride as demanded by bride

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

In Islamic marriage, the groom must provide Mahr (often translated as dowry) to the bride as a mandatory gift. This is a fundamental requirement in Islamic marriage law. The options about bride's parents giving dowry reflect non-Islamic cultural practices (dowry from bride's family is actually prohibited in Islam). Option D, while using the term 'dowry' instead of 'Mahr', correctly identifies that the payment goes from groom to bride.
